Description

360° Mounting for Laser Beam Shutters

Compared to the LS-20 Series, the LS-30 Series of shutters are operable in any direction in the vertical and horizontal position to allow for a wider range of mounting options to better suit your needs. The LS-30 Shutters feature spring-loaded blades.

Beam shutters are designed to form part of a high-integrity safety system and features a spring-operated blade and force-disconnect proving contacts. When closed, the shutter deflects the incoming laser beam onto an internal beam dump where the energy is converted to heat which is dissipated in the aluminium casing of the shutter. When the shutter is open, the laser beam passes through the shutter without interruption.

Standard, SIL rated, and OEM Versions

Four variations are available in the LS-30 Series including a SIL-rated version and OEM version.

A SIL3 version is available which, when correctly wired to a Lasermet Interlock® Control System, can meets Safety Integrity Level 3 to IEC 61508-1 and Performance Level ‘e’ to EN 13849-1.

The LS-30 also comes in an OEM version, designed to be integrated into user equipment to create a custom laser product with built-in laser shutters.

Control Options

Standard operation is by means of the ‘Open’ and ‘Close’ buttons on top of the shutter case, remote switching is also possible. Alternatively the shutter can be set to open as soon as power is applied. In all cases the shutter will close when power is removed.

Beam Shutter for High Power Lasers

The maximum average power for use with the internal beam dump is 20W. However for higher powers the beam dump can be easily removed by unscrewing it from the side of the shutter case. Beam tubes can be fitted and the beam can be directed to a remote beam dump. This allows the shutter to be used for much higher powers, even for multi-kilowatt lasers.

Shutter Blade Options

The shutter blade is made of stainless steel which is sufficient for most applications. However, ceramic or mirror blades can be factory fitted to the blade if required. An external beam dump option is also available.

LS-RS30 Remote Switching for Laser Beams

Remote Shutter Control

LS-RS30 Remote Shutter Switching Station

A remote switching station is available, allowing the shutter to be opened and closed by pressing buttons remote from the shutter itself. As well as start and stop buttons there is LED indication of ‘power on’, ‘open’ and ‘closed’.

Distribution Box for LS-30 Beam Shutters

These are wall mountable distribution boxes with terminals for connection to a Lasermet ICS Interlock® control system or other shutter power supply.
